The Cross-Border Validation Bottleneck in the Australian Market
Expanding global consumer brands, digital platforms, and B2B2C services into Australia presents a distinct operational paradox for cross-border insights leads. The Australian market is commercially lucrative, digitally sophisticated, and an ideal launchpad for wider APAC distribution. However, running conventional consumer validation from North American or European headquarters faces structural friction.
First, physical recruitment across Australian territories is disproportionately expensive relative to total market size. With a population concentrated in major coastal hubs like Sydney, Melbourne, Brisbane, and Perth, but differentiated by suburban, regional, and climatic dynamics, purchasing human panel samples incurs steep per-respondent recruitment costs.
Second, the structural timezone penalty between London or New York and Sydney severely slows research velocity. Iterative testing cycles that take days internally stretch into weeks when managing local agency handoffs, screener approvals, and asynchronous respondent schedules.
Third, standardized global concepts routinely fail in Australia because of subtle cultural misalignments. Australian consumers exhibit high skepticism toward aggressive brand hyperbole, maintain deeply entrenched shopping habits across dominant retail channels such as the Coles and Woolworths supermarket duopoly or Chemist Warehouse, and respond negatively to imported American or British messaging that feels culturally tone-deaf.
Global research leaders need an agile method to pressure-test value propositions, packaging architecture, pricing tier structures, and creative copy against regional Australian expectations before locking in physical validation budgets.

The Cultural Resonance Gap
Australian consumer psychology balances casual pragmatism with a low tolerance for over-engineered marketing claims. Known culturally as the tall poppy reaction, consumers readily dismiss brands that over-promise or project unearned authority. When global teams adapt global copy simply by swapping currency symbols to AUD, the concept frequently misfires. Concepts must align with local cadence: understated confidence, straightforward utility, and authentic value.
The Concentrated Retail and Digital Landscape
Consumer choice in Australia is heavily shaped by distinct infrastructure. Grocery, personal care, and retail distribution are dominated by specific players. Payment ecosystems prioritize contactless payment and Buy Now Pay Later adoption at rates exceeding many Northern Hemisphere markets. If an imported concept ignores how Australians navigate retail shelves or digital checkouts, early testing yields skewed conclusions.

Step 3: Run MaxDiff Attribute and Claim Prioritization
To determine which product features or marketing claims drive genuine interest versus indifference, construct an executable MaxDiff design within Minds.
Instead of asking personas to rate claims on a standard rating scale where everything appears somewhat important, MaxDiff forces trade-offs across randomized sets.
Sample MaxDiff Setup for a Premium Consumer Packaged Good (CPG) Concept:
- Claim 1: Sourced entirely from Australian regenerative farms.
- Claim 2: 100% recyclable, zero-plastic packaging.
- Claim 3: Priced at parity with conventional national brands.
- Claim 4: Certified carbon neutral production.
- Claim 5: Endorsed by independent health and nutrition bodies.
- Claim 6: Free from artificial preservatives and refined sugars.
Minds processes these forced-choice sets across your configured Australian target groups, delivering mathematical preference scores that highlight which claims act as primary drivers and which generate zero commercial differentiation.

When is physical or recruited-human research necessary?
- Sensory and Organoleptic Testing: Taste, scent, tactile packaging feel, and physical ergonomics require in-person consumer interaction.
- Regulated Claims & Legal Submissions: Formal regulatory filings and compliance-mandated health claim validations require human panel trials.
- High-Stakes Final Gate Checks: Large-scale capital investments or multi-million dollar regional media buys may use recruited-human panel validation as a final confirmation step after Minds has refined the underlying concept.
